ABOUT MYODUR:

MYODUR targets muscle cells by using a carnitine carnitine /car·ni·tine/ (kahr´ni-ten) a betaine derivative involved in the transport of fatty acids into mitochondria, where they are metabolized.

car·ni·tine
n.
 carrier molecule and inhibits calpain by attaching a leupeptin analogue onto the carrier. Leupeptin has been studied extensively in a variety of animal models and was shown to be an effective means of slowing or delaying muscle wasting.  membranes. CepTor's technology uses the carnitine carrier molecule to direct the leupeptin analogue into targeted cells where it inhibits the up-regulation of calpain. Therefore, by targeting a calpain inhibitor to muscle cells, it is believed that MYODUR will prevent the degradation and promote the preservation of functional muscle.

ABOUT CALPAIN:

Calpain exists in every cell of the body and is a protease that degrades cellular proteins naturally in a normal metabolic process. When calpain is abnormally up regulated, the accelerated degradation process breaks down cells and tissues faster than they can be restored, resulting in several serious neuromuscular and neurodegenerative diseases.

CepTor Corporation is a development-stage biopharmaceutical company engaged in the discovery, development, and commercialization of proprietary, cell-targeted therapeutic products for the treatment of neuromuscular and neurodegenerative diseases with a focus on orphan diseases. The Company's mission is to increase the quality and quantity of life of people suffering with these diseases. An orphan disease is defined in the United States as a serious or life-threatening disease that affects less than 200,000 people and for which no definitive therapy currently exists. CepTor Corporation seeks to create an efficient orphan drug platform by taking advantage of the legislative, regulatory and commercial opportunities common to these rare diseases.
